As part of our continued growth, we now have a fantastic opportunity for an Administration Manager to join our close-knit team at Stretton Shires School.
To work alongside the Headteacher to effectively develop and manage the Administration Team to provide comprehensive, confidential administrative support to the Service. To be responsible for the planning, development, and implementation of HR and administrative services within the school.
The Administration Manager is responsible for providing administrative management services to the school. This includes overseeing the Admin Department, maintaining high standards of HR, ensuring efficient administration services, and supervising the office staff.
Ensure all stakeholders benefit from high standards of service.
Member of the SLT and responsible for the Administration Department to provide a safe environment for all – pupils, staff, visitors, and contractors.
Main point of contact for central services – including HR, Recruitment, Resourcing, and IT.

Set in the heart of the Rutland countryside, Stretton Shires School is an independent day and residential school catering for autistic young people and those with associated needs, offering specialist secondary education for pupils aged 11 – 18.
Established in 2005 as a residential home and school, we are currently growing our day pupil numbers, meaning we constantly need to recruit passionate and dedicated staff to support our growth aspirations.
Our aim for the young people coming to Stretton Shires is quite simple; we want every young person to progress developmentally, educationally, and socially. We want them to develop an understanding of themselves and to experience what success feels like. Through these actions, we can equip every young person with the skills and knowledge they need to succeed.
